Punter Blake Gillikin exits Cardinals-Seahawks with ankle injury

Dec 8, 2024, 3:50 PM | Updated: 9:50 pm

GLENDALE — Arizona Cardinals punter Blake Gillikin exited Sunday’s 30-18 loss to the Seattle Seahawks with an ankle injury.

Gillikin was seen in visible discomfort following his lone punt — that went for 63 yards — of the afternoon.

He came off limping before a lengthy evaluation in the blue medical tent.

In place of Gillikin was kicker Chad Ryland.

Ryland attempted one punt in the second quarter that went for 36 yards.

On top of his added punting duties, Ryland was 1-for-1 on field goals and had an extra point.

Gillikin has been a bright spot for Arizona this season after joining on as a midseason addition last year.

In 25 career games with Arizona, Gillikin is averaging 43.4 net yards per punt. He’s pinned opposing offenses inside their 20-yard line 30 times.
